Output d80c63ce2ee38f56f9f19b9b016a98dd89b97a4d837f1067fcb74ded65bcfa17:0

value
1802642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20b6f8ca0c719f0da636ce0c528274ed2b40bbf7 OP_EQUAL
address
34fzjnfdKhbN5NVDdnExX6qzboZKKXxRYF
transaction
d80c63ce2ee38f56f9f19b9b016a98dd89b97a4d837f1067fcb74ded65bcfa17
spent
true